Task (15 mins)


Use a Google spreadsheet to setup and format a spreadsheet using the following parameters

  1. Do not type ANYTHING in row 1 or column A
  2. Add a column of LABELS for fixed costs
  3. Use the next column for the DATA for the fixed costs
  4. Leave a blank column
  5. Add a column of LABELS for the variable costs
  6. Use the next column for the DATA for the variable costs
  7. Leave an empty column for the totals of the variable costs
Screen Shot 2013-11-25 at 17.12.10.png

Format your spreadsheet by
  1. Merging cells for your TITLES
  2. Adding borders for each section
  3. Adding a colour to your LABEL cells
